Thames River Splashes Out on Regional Sales

UK-based fund manager Thames River Capital has appointed two executives to propel delivery and sales to intermediaries and professional investors in the regions. Jason Anderson, previously at Fidelity International, will steer intermediary sales across southern England, while Paul Moulton, formerly with Scottish Widows, will cover northern regions and Scotland. The fund manager said that the appointments would bring the sales and marketing team to 21 in strength. Thames River was established in 1998 and, together with its Nevsky Capital affiliate, managed over $11 billion as at 31 May 2007.
